Transaction 2504667032a15b2baee0c91bae16481fd6d9c01e13bc85ee8d7a4379c453ab56

2 Input
2 Outputs
  • 2504667032a15b2baee0c91bae16481fd6d9c01e13bc85ee8d7a4379c453ab56:0
  • value  1068951
    address  3CvXagcMzYNBbrpuy2V21sXsTAKYBnG9xA
  • 2504667032a15b2baee0c91bae16481fd6d9c01e13bc85ee8d7a4379c453ab56:1
  • value  1409500
    address  17bbLjL7Vx5H7V3uBCs8hjz3q8rGr2oXMr